X-Git-Url: https://git.sthu.org/?a=blobdiff_plain;f=lenovo-x220-linuxacpi%2Fetc%2Facpi%2Factions%2Fbtn-vga.sh;h=9d0b9648a49103ced254ff47668c7c3615da1534;hb=17e8cb5fab982a727f72846e49b2bb837b58b8c2;hp=629b400a6e4177dfb8b3ba64f1f2b446b20d71b3;hpb=3940751562b91c8ff785e902a618cc0bf71e2b5e;p=shutils.git diff --git a/lenovo-x220-linuxacpi/etc/acpi/actions/btn-vga.sh b/lenovo-x220-linuxacpi/etc/acpi/actions/btn-vga.sh index 629b400..9d0b964 100755 --- a/lenovo-x220-linuxacpi/etc/acpi/actions/btn-vga.sh +++ b/lenovo-x220-linuxacpi/etc/acpi/actions/btn-vga.sh @@ -1,11 +1,12 @@ #! /bin/sh . /usr/local/bin/getXenv.inc +getXconsole STATEFILE="/var/run/vgastate" LVDS1_defaultmode="1366x768" -function vgaoff +vgaoff() { logger "Turn external video off, putting LVDS1 to standard setup" xrandr --output VGA1 --off \ @@ -14,7 +15,7 @@ function vgaoff echo "vgaoff" > $STATEFILE } -function vgamirror +vgamirror() { logger "Mirror LVDS1 to $1" xrandr --output $1 --primary --auto \ @@ -22,7 +23,7 @@ function vgamirror echo "vgamirror" > $STATEFILE } -function vgarightof +vgarightof() { logger "Putting $1 right of of LVDS1" xrandr --output LVDS1 --primary --auto --mode $LVDS1_defaultmode \ @@ -30,7 +31,7 @@ function vgarightof echo "vgarightof" > $STATEFILE } -function vgaleftof +vgaleftof() { logger "Putting $1 left of of LVDS1" xrandr --output LVDS1 --primary --auto --mode $LVDS1_defaultmode \